這篇文章主要介紹了jquery select下拉框操作小結(推薦)的相關資料,非常實用,在前端開發經常可以用到,需要的朋友可以參考下
jquery獲取select元素,並選擇的text和value:
1. $("#select_id").change(function()); //為select新增事件,當選擇其中一項時觸發
2. var checktext=$("#select_id").find("option:selected").text(); //獲取select選擇的text
3. var checkvalue=$("#select_id").val(); //獲取select選擇的value
4. var checkindex=$("#select_id ").get(0).selectedindex; //獲取select選擇的索引值
5. var maxindex=$("#select_id option:last").attr("index"); //獲取select最大的索引值
jquery獲取select元素,並設定的 text和value:
例項分析:
1. $("#select_id ").get(0).selectedindex=1; //設定select索引值為1的項選中
2. $("#select_id ").val(4); // 設定select的value值為4的項選中
3. $("#select_id option[text='jquery']").attr("selected", true); //設定select的text值為jquery的項選中
jquery新增/刪除select元素的option項:
例項分析:
**分類?
onchange=
"getfourthlevel()"
>
請選擇**分類
四級分類:?
請選擇四級分類
.
if
($(
"#thirdlevel"
).val()!=0)
if
($(
"#fourthlevelid"
).val()!=0)
//這個表示:假如我們希望當選擇選擇第三類時:如果第四類中有資料則刪除,如果沒有資料第四類的商品中的為預設值。在後面學習了ajax技術後經常會使用到!
獲取select :
獲取select 選中的 text :
$("#ddlregtype").find("option:selected").text();
獲取select選中的 value:
$("#ddlregtype ").val();
獲取select選中的索引:
$("#ddlregtype ").get(0).selectedindex;
設定select:
設定select 選中的索引:
$("#ddlregtype ").get(0).selectedindex=index;//index為索引值
設定select 選中的value:
$("#ddlregtype ").attr("value","normal「);
$("#ddlregtype ").val("normal");
$("#ddlregtype ").get(0).value = value;
設定select 選中的text:?
var
count=$(
"#ddlregtype option"
).length;
for
(
var
i=0;i
}
$(
"#select_id option[text='jquery']"
).attr(
"selected"
,
true
);
設定select option項:?
$(
"#select_id"
"text"
);
//新增一項option
$(
"#select_id"
).prepend(
"請選擇"
);
//在前面插入一項option
$(
"#select_id option:last"
).remove();
//刪除索引值最大的option
$(
"#select_id option[index='0']"
).remove();
//刪除索引值為0的option
$(
"#select_id option[value='3']"
).remove();
//刪除值為3的option
$(
"#select_id option[text='4']"
).remove();
//刪除text值為4的option
清空 select:
$("#ddlregtype ").empty();
jquery獲得值:
.val()
.text()
設定值.val('在這裡設定值')?
$(
"document"
).ready(
function
())
$(
"#btn2"
).click(
function
())
$(
"#btn3"
).click(
function
())
$(
"#btn4"
).click(
function
()
else
})
})
$(
"#btn5"
).click(
function
())
alert(str);
})
})
下拉框 列舉
列舉 public enum mchtprofitsplittype public string getvalue class 初始化中要放到下拉列表裡的 分賬方式列舉mchtprofitsplittype listorgprofitsplittypelist new arraylist mchtp...
下拉框元件
createselect.js text 建立民族陣列 var arraynation new array 漢族 蒙古族 彝族 侗族 哈薩克族 畲族 納西族 仫佬族 仡佬族 怒族 保安族 鄂倫春族 回族 壯族 瑤族 傣族 高山族 景頗族 羌族 錫伯族 烏孜別克族 裕固族 赫哲族 藏族 布依族 白族 ...
下拉框賦值
針對combox控制項,對下拉框賦值 domain ligercombobox data表示的就是資料來源,cancelable 如果設定為true,那就表示該下拉框中的值可以被刪除,叉掉,重新進行選擇。第二種情況是 如果將下拉框中的值不靈活使用,即寫死,那就如下建立資料來源 var test 其實...